Nielsens: 36.3 million go for Oscar gold
•Oscar glory. ABC's Academy Awards drew 36.3 million viewers Sunday, up about 4 million over last year but still the show's third-lowest ever. Also up were the Barbara Walters Special (11.5 million), red-carpet preview (24.4 million) and E!'s two-hour arrivals fest (2.8 million). Still, Fox won the weekly race.
•Dance-off. Disney Channel took the crown over Nickelodeon Monday as original movie Dadnapped (4.6 million) bested its rival Spectacular (3.7 million).
•Second weeks. Fox's Dollhouse fell to 4.3 million, down half a million from its unspectacular opener, but HBO's Eastbound and Down (616,000), though low, held up nicely against the Oscars despite plunging lead-in Flight of the Conchords (469,000). Comedy Central's Important Things With Demetri Martin (1.7 million) dropped 30% of its premiere-week audience.
•En fuego. Univision's finale of telenovela Fuego en la Sangre (Fire in the Blood) scored a big 6.6 million viewers Friday.
•Chancepays. HBO's Taking Chance saluted 2 million viewers Saturday, the pay channel's biggest audience for an original movie since 2004. Monday's documentary Right America:Feeling Wronged was low with 495,000.
•So long. The near-certain series finales of CBS' Worst Week (8.7 million Monday) and CW horror-reality series 13: Fear Is Real (800,000 Friday) were typically inadequate.
•Cable notes. Friday's season send-offs of USA's Monk (5.5 million) and Psych (4.8 million) were big; Bravo's Real Housewives of New York opened its second season with a series-high 1.6 million viewers behind Orange County's fourth-season finale (2 million); TLC's Little People, Big World returned Monday with 1.8 million; and the season premiere of TV Land's High School Reunion managed 726,000 Wednesday.
